"Alien: Earth Release Date, Episode Count, and Story Details Revealed"

Jun 26,25(5 months ago)

The highly anticipated series *Alien: Earth* is set to make its debut with the first two episodes on **August 12**, available at **8pm ET** exclusively on **Hulu** in the U.S., while international audiences can catch it on **FX and Disney+** at **8pm PT / ET**. Following this premiere, new episodes of the eight-episode season will roll out every Tuesday.

Set in the year **2120**, which falls well after the events of *Prometheus* and just two years prior to the original *Alien*, Noah Hawley’s *Alien: Earth* follows a thrilling narrative centered around the deep-space research vessel **USCSS Maginot**, which crash-lands on Earth. The story follows a determined young woman named **Wendy** (played by Sydney Chandler) and a group of tactical soldiers as they uncover a chilling secret that brings them face-to-face with an unimaginable threat to the planet.

For context, the recent interquel *Alien: Romulus* takes place between *Alien* and *Aliens*, offering fans a deeper look into the timeline. In *Alien: Earth*, the world has evolved under the control of five dominant corporations: **Weyland-Yutani**, **Prodigy**, **Lynch**, **Dynamic**, and **Threshold**. Humanity coexists with cyborgs and synthetics—humanoid robots powered by artificial intelligence. However, the landscape shifts dramatically when the CEO of Prodigy unveils a groundbreaking innovation: hybrids—synthetic beings infused with human consciousness. Wendy is not only the first prototype of this technology but also a pivotal step in the franchise’s ongoing exploration of immortality.

One intriguing plot point reveals that after Weyland-Yutani’s spaceship collides with **Prodigy City**, Wendy and the other hybrid prototypes come into contact with unknown life forms described as “more terrifying than anyone could have ever imagined.” This hints at the presence of multiple monstrous entities throughout the series, possibly including variations of the iconic Xenomorph or entirely new alien threats—reportedly numbering up to five distinct creatures.

Back in January last year, showrunner **Noah Hawley** clarified why he chose not to incorporate the backstory established in Prometheus for *Alien: Earth*. He expressed a preference for the "retro-futurism" of the original *Alien* films. Although Hawley engaged in extensive discussions with director **Ridley Scott** about various elements of the franchise—including its connections to the prequels—he ultimately opted to diverge from the bioweapon narrative introduced in *Prometheus*, favoring instead the foundational lore of the original movies.

This marks an exciting time for the *Alien* universe. Alongside *Alien: Earth*, production is underway on *Alien: Romulus 2*, and there are confirmed plans for a crossover with the Predator franchise via *Predator: Badlands*, expanding the sci-fi horror universe like never before.
